我们可以将上面的代码保存为tree.py,然后在终端中运行: python tree.py 1. 你将看到一个展示当前目录结构的树状图。 添加更多功能 高级选项 我们还可以给这个 tree 命令增加一些基本选项,比如只显示文件或者只显示目录。下面是添加这些功能后的代码: importosimportsysdeftree(directory,padding,only_dirs=False,only...
tree = Tree() tree.add(0) tree.add(1) tree.add(2) tree.add(3) tree.add(4) tree.add(5) tree.add(6) tree.add(7) tree.add(8) tree.add(9) tree.breadth_travel() print("") tree.preorder(tree.root) print("") tree.inorder(tree.root) print("") tree.postorder(tree.root) p...
一、基于原生Python实现决策树(Decision Tree) 决策树是一种基本的分类和回归方法,可以用于二元和多元分类以及连续和离散的数值预测。决策树的构建过程就是递归地选择最优的特征并根据该特征对数据进行分裂的过程,直到满足某种条件为止,然后构建出一颗决策树。在进行分类预测时,对输入数据从根节点开始沿着特定的路径向下...
进行中
python - python实现tree命令 tree 命令 : 显示目录的树形结构 [root@localhosttest]# ls222 aaaa bbbb cccc.txt [root@localhosttest]# tree. ├── 222 ├── aaaa │?? ├── 1111.txt │?? └── qqqq │?? └── fdfd │?? └── jjjj...
机器学习之决策树(Decision Tree)及其Python代码实现 决策树是一个预测模型;他代表的是对象属性与对象值之间的一种映射关系。树中每个节点表示某个对象,而每个分叉路径则代表的某个可能的属性值,而每个叶结点则对应从根节点到该叶节点所经历的路径所表示的对象的值。决策树仅有单一输出,若欲有复数输出,可以建立独立...
早就耳闻python功能强大,互联网领域运用广泛,Scrapy爬虫框架、OpenStack云存储架构都是用Python实现的。最近下定决心,开始学习Python。先参考网上的demo写一个小例子,实现linux tree命令。 代码语言:javascript 代码运行次数:0 运行 AI代码解释 #!/usr/bin/pythonimportos,sys,stringclassXXXTree:def__init__(self):...
KNN的介绍与kdTree的Python实现 K 近邻法 K 近邻 - K Nearest Neighbor - KNN 一句话描述:给定一个训练数据集,对于新输入的实例,在训练数据集中找到与之最邻近的k个实例,投票决定输入实例的类别 1、输入数据集 T={(x1,y1),(x2,y2),…,(xn,yn)} ;其中 xi 为第i 个数据的特征向量; yi∈Y={c1,...
python+easyuitree实现 python+easyuitree实现 前台: $('#trees').tree({ ,loadFilter: function(data){ if (data.d){ return data.d;} else { return data;} } });后台:def tree_roledb(request):a=[]list_items = Roledb.objects.all()for p in list_items.values():a.append(p)print ...
【BigTree:Python中的树结构实现与方法,集成列表、字典、pandas和polars DataFrame】'bigtree - Tree Implementation and Methods for Python' GitHub: github.com/kayjan/bigtree #Python# #树结构# #数据结构与算法# û收藏 37 评论 ñ26 评论 o p 同时转发到我的微博 按热度 ...